One cold winter morning, a great rumbling sound shakes the citizens of San Idrox. But a long forgotten threat awakens that day as well. Meanwhile, unaware of the fate that awaits them, the Nimbus brothers set off on their regular business trip to Capitol. On the way, they will be stalked and mercilessly attacked, with many questions arising about their enemy's motives. They will only find the answers in a past which has been hidden from them. On their journey, they will come across wizards, knights and strange creatures, and find some unexpected allies.

Author Description

A Spanish civil servant, a graduate in Business Studies and a lover of fantasy literature and science fiction. Author of the novels The Three Magic Stones, fantasy literature, and Utopia 2079, science fiction. He has also written various short stories, including Llevado por la corriente [Taken by the current] and Una llamada del pasado [A call from the past], which were published by Líneas Difusas in the books entitled Ilusiones Entre Líneas [Illusions Between Lines] and Retales [Cuttings]. Another notable story is Un legado para la posteridad [A legacy for posterity], which tells the story of Apolonio, a prestigious artisan in the Roman city of Astigi in the 2nd century AD. He has also written, designed and done artwork for the former literary journal: Littera. Un Café con… [A coffee with…] was a regular feature in the journal with fictitious, informative and humorous interviews with the greatest writers of all time. Some of its most illustrious guests were: Miguel de Cervantes, Tolkien, Jules Verne and Michael Crichton.
